#A4FFBC Color
#A4FFBC is rgb(164, 255, 188) in RGB, hsl(136, 100%, 82%) in HSL, and about cmyk(36%, 0%, 26%, 0%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Teal Deer (#99E6B3), visibly different at ΔE 11.49.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#A4FFBC Channel Values
How #A4FFBC bre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 164 · G 255 · B 188 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 136° · S 100% · L 82%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 136° · S 36% · V 100%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 36% · M 0% · Y 26% · K 0%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.19:1 vs white · 17.61: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#A4FFBC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#A4FFBC?
#A4FFBC is a lightest green — rgb(164, 255, 188) in RGB and hsl(136, 100%, 82%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Teal Deer (#99E6B3), which is visibly different at a CIE76 distance of 11.49.
What is the RGB value of #A4FFBC?
#A4FFBC is rgb(164, 255, 188) — red 164, green 255, and blue 188 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#A4FFBC?
#A4FFBC converts to approximately cmyk(36%, 0%, 26%, 0%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#A4FFBC be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#A4FFBC scores 1.19:1 against white and 17.61: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#A4FFBC as a CSS color keyword?
No. #A4FFBC is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ightgreen (#90EE90) at a CIE76 distance of 15.34, which is visibly different.
